名词 n.
  1. Birdsong by a large number of birds occurring in the early morning.
    — But the music of the spring-tide is past; the cuckoo is no longer vocal; the dawn-chorus is silent; summer has stilled the voices that but lately trilled so tirelessly, and, until another spring arrives, hedgerow and spinney will not again resound with the singing of the birds.
  2. Radio interference sometimes experienced at sunrise.
    — [T]he dawn chorus usually has a characteristic chirpy sound, but at times changes into a hiss not unlike tube noise. […] Several investigators, including the author, have at times noticed a tendency for the dawn chorus to change intensity for a short period immediately following some lightning strokes. This may indicate a change in propagation conditions due to the electromagnetic or ionization effect of the strokes.

词源

From dawn (noun) + chorus (noun). Piecewise doublet of dawn choir.
